             HENDERSON TECHNOLOGY TRUST PLC
                            
                            
                 ANNUAL GENERAL MEETING
                            
                  THURSDAY 27 JULY 2000


At  the  Annual  General Meeting of Henderson  Technology
Trust held today, Brian Ashford-Russell, Fund Manager and
Director commented that:

"The  Company's new financial year has got off to a  good
start.   By  25 July, our total net assets had  risen  by
approximately  9% to #732m from our 30  April  year  end.
This  compares  very  satisfactorily with  our  composite
technology index which has risen by less than  1%  and  a
rise  of  under  4%  in  the FTSE World  Index  (Sterling
adjusted).

Technology shares in the USA have recovered strongly from
their mid - May lows and have also bottomed - albeit less
convincingly  - in both Europe and Asia.  Second  quarter
earnings  figures from the US Technology sector  provided
convincing  evidence of accelerating  spending  in  areas
such  as  web enabled applications software and broadband
communications.    Moreover,   recent   evidence   of   a
deceleration in the pace of the US economy's  growth  has
provided   a  more  sanguine  background  for  technology
investors.   NASDAQ's  recovery has helped  to  stabilise
technology shares elsewhere in the world. However, it  is
notable that both share prices and the earnings growth of
European  and  Asian technology companies  have  markedly
underperformed those of their US counterparts.   We  have
benefited from this development following our decision in
the Spring to reorient our portfolio towards the USA.

Over  the short term, we expect the technology sector  to
be   'range  -  bound'.   High  absolute  valuations,   a
continuing flow of new and secondary issues together with
investor  concerns about the direction of the US  economy
all  provide  sufficient fuel for the bears  to  cap  the
sector's  upside.  However, outstanding  earnings  growth
and the absence of it in other parts of the market, still
strong  mutual  fund  flows and the prospect  of  a  soft
landing  in  the US provide counter balancing  ammunition
for  the  bulls.   Longer term we remain very  optimistic
about the outlook for technology shares and expect a more
sustainable uptrend to commence some time in  the  fourth
quarter."

Notes to Editors:

The Benchmark is a blend of worldwide technology indices,
comprising 50% Pacific SE Technology, 15% Morgan  Stanley
Eurotec,  7.5%  Techmark, 7.5% Euro  NM,  15%  Datastream
Asian  Electronics  and  5%  JASDAQ.   The  second   part
comprises a longer term incentive and will be at the rate
of 5% of the amount, if any, by which the increase in the
undiluted  net  asset value of the ordinary  shares  over
each  three year period exceeds LIBOR +5% over  the  same
period.   Each  three year period will  be  discrete  and
hence the first will end on 30 April 2003

Pacific SE Technology-     A  long  standing and  broadly
                     based  US  technology index  against
                     which  the  US part of the portfolio
                     has been benchmarked for many years.

Morgan Stanley Eurotec     -    Is Morgan Stanley's index
                     of  mid  and large cap pan  European
                     technology stocks.

Euro NM              -     The leading Stock Exchange for
                     growth stocks in continental Europe.

Datastream Asian Electronics   -    Is Datastream's index
                     of  electronic manufacturers in Asia
                     including Japan.

JASDAQ               -     Japan's answer to the  NASDAQ.
                     An   index   with  Japanese   growth
                     stocks.
